#ifndef NN_H
#define NN_H
#include <QMutex>
#include <QWaitCondition>
#include "game.h"
#include "node.h"
#include "neural/network.h"
class Computation {
public:
Computation(QSharedPointer<lczero::Network> network);
~Computation();
void reset();
int addPositionToEvaluate(const Node *node);
int positions() const { return m_positions; }
void evaluate();
void clear();
float qVal(int index) const;
void setPVals(int index, Node *node) const;
private:
int m_positions;
QSharedPointer<lczero::Network> m_network;
lczero::NetworkComputation *m_computation;
std::vector<lczero::InputPlane> m_inputPlanes;
};
class NeuralNet {
public:
static NeuralNet *globalInstance();
void reset();
void setWeights(const QString &pathToWeights);
Computation *acquireNetwork(); // will block until a network is ready
void releaseNetwork(Computation*); // must be called when you are done
private:
NeuralNet();
~NeuralNet();
lczero::Network *createNewGPUNetwork(int id, bool fp16, bool useCustomWinograd) const;
QVector<Computation*> m_availableNetworks;
QMutex m_mutex;
QWaitCondition m_condition;
bool m_weightsValid;
bool m_usingFP16;
bool m_usingCustomWinograd;
friend class Computation;
friend class MyNeuralNet;
};
#endif // NN_H
